Executive readout · one minute

What matters this quarter

Fluor reported full-year 2025 revenue of $15.5 billion with new awards of $12.0 billion and ending backlog of $25.5 billion, while posting a net loss that reflected the Santos ruling and a $2 billion NuScale valuation writedown. Management expects 2026 awards to be significantly higher, supported by NuScale proceeds funding a $1.4 billion planned share repurchase program.

Key takeaways

What improved, and what deserves a closer read.

Constructive signals

  • Full-year 2025 new awards were $12.0 billion, 87% reimbursable, with ending backlog of $25.5 billion at 81% reimbursable and positive backlog adjustments of $941 million.
  • Management expects 2026 new awards to be significantly higher than 2025 with a book-to-burn ratio in excess of one, including a potential multibillion-dollar Cernavodă nuclear EPC award.
  • $754 million of share repurchases completed in 2025 with a planned $1.4 billion in 2026, supported by $1.35 billion in NuScale proceeds received in Q1 2026 and full monetization expected by end of Q2 2026.
  • Urban Solutions full-year segment profit was $205 million, including $54 million of positive developments on infrastructure projects, with $8.7 billion of new awards.
  • Cash and marketable securities of $2.2 billion at year-end with G&A expenses down 3% year-over-year.
  • Management affirmed confidence in reaching the 2028 financial objectives laid out at the prior Investor Day.

Risks & pressure points

  • Full-year 2025 GAAP net loss attributable to Fluor of $51 million, including a $643 million adverse Santos ruling.
  • Q4 2025 net loss attributable to Fluor of $1.6 billion, or ($9.87) per diluted share, reflecting a $2 billion reduction in the NuScale investment valuation.
  • Energy Solutions reported a full-year segment loss of $414 million, versus a $256 million profit in 2024.
  • Urban Solutions full-year profit of $205 million was down from $304 million a year ago, with $108 million in cost growth on three infrastructure projects still in a loss position.
  • Operating cash flow was ($387) million versus $828 million in the prior year.
